Why is random sampling important

Social Studies
1 answer:
GREYUIT [131]3 years ago
8 0

Random sampling is important because it gives a more accurate view of different people's views of the topic.

Where did general gates and conway send lafayette?
Oksi-84 [34.3K]

Answer:

A. Back to France

Explanation:

Lafayette was a French military man who was present in the American revolution along with the army that sought independence from the colonies. He was an aristocrat and was essential for the victory of the colonies over England. After being wounded in a battle, he was sent back to France, where he was to negotiate support from the French government for supplies that would help the American army continue to advance in the conflict.

Xie-he's writings on the importance of the "spirit consonance" of painting reflect the daoist notion of _____, the energy flowin
valentinak56 [21]
<span>Xie-he's writings reflect the daoist notion of qi yun. Qi yun expresses the idea that energy is flowing through all things. Qi exists in everything in nature, such as people and animals. Yun refers to the idea of harmony. When combined, the idea expressed is that all beings in nature are in harmony and have energy flowing through them. This harmonious energy must also flow from the painter to the painting.</span>
